My son is 14 and may need braces. Will the insurance cover this?
This is a question we get a lot. Will dental insurance cover orthodontic procedures such as having braces fitted? The answer is usually no. The fitting of braces is often considered as an ‘elective treatment’, meaning it is not essential and may only be required for cosmetic reasons.
There may be cases where your dentist decides that braces are necessary and therefore their fitting is not only for cosmetic reasons. In these cases your insurance may cover the cost of treatment up to a certain level, or even 100% of the cost.
